Gbenga Ogunbote: We want to break all records

Enugu based NPFL, side, Rangers International, are ready to kickstart their 2019 season in the domestic league, according to their manager, Gbenga Ogunbote.

Rangers battle Mountain of Fire and Miracles Ministry football club, MFM, in a week four encounter billed for the Soccer Temple stadium in Agege, Lagos, on Wednesday.

The match is set to be the sixth meeting between the two sides, with the visitors having the edge in their head to head, having won two games compared to MFM’s one in their previous five.

However, the 2016 league winners are yet to taste victory at the Temple, but are now ready to change that in the words of their coach, Ogunbote, who says there is always a first time.

Rangers International training in Lagos

“Oh, that’s good, we want to break all records,” Ogunbote said after he was reminded by this aclsports.com reporter that Rangers had never won at Agege moments after his team’s final training session on Tuesday.

“There is always a first time, and they have been in the league for four weeks and this is our first game. [So] we want to see what we can get out of the domestic league, too.”

The Flying Antelopes will play their first match of the season in the 2019 campaign after a very busy but successful schedule in the CAF Confederation Cup, CAFCC, where they have safely secured their place in the lucrative group stages of the competition.

On their plan against the Olukoya Boys, the Rangers gaffer says his side will give it their best as every point is very important.

“We will do our best [against MFM], and more importantly [given] that it is an abridged league,” he added. “Every point is important, [so] we are here to see what our strength and gut can get us.”

The game between these two is one of 11 slated for Wednesday and will kickoff at 4pm at the Soccer Temple in Agege.
